Introducing Artmachine: Generative Art at Your Fingertips
What is Generative Art?
Generative art is a captivating fusion of creativity and exploration, built on a simple yet powerful idea: the artistic process unfolds in two distinct phases. First, an autonomous system is designed—this system follows a set of rules, algorithms, or procedural methods. In the second phase, it runs independently, generating results without direct intervention from the artist.
Unlike traditional art, where every brushstroke is intentional, generative art embraces unpredictability. The artist defines the framework, but the final output emerges organically, often revealing unexpected beauty through structured processes.
It's important to note that generative art does not necessarily require computers. It’s a broad artistic approach that predates digital technology. Many artists have explored generative principles using purely manual methods, such as rule-based paintings, chance-driven compositions, or geometric tiling patterns. However, computers are particularly well-suited to this approach, offering immense processing power to explore complex, evolving patterns at scale.

Enter Artmachine
Artmachine is an intuitive web-based tool that brings generative art to your fingertips. Instead of manually drawing or painting, you create artworks using a system of building blocks—also known as nodes. Each artwork is essentially a graph of interconnected nodes, where each node represents a mathematical function, algorithm, or transformation. These nodes process and feed data into each other, ultimately generating a unique visual output.
Each node has adjustable parameters that influence the final image—tweaking values might modify colors, distort shapes, or introduce intricate textures. This approach allows for both structured design and endless creative possibilities.

A Twist on Generative Art: Evolution
What sets Artmachine apart from other tools is its ability to evolve artworks over time. You can think of each artwork as having its own DNA—the underlying graph of nodes—just as organisms in nature have DNA that determines how they grow and function. In Artmachine, artworks can evolve by introducing targeted or random modifications to this DNA.
Mutations can be subtle, such as small parameter adjustments that create gentle variations, or radical, completely rewiring the graph by replacing nodes or changing their connections. These mutations can be introduced manually by editing the graph, but also be generated automatically. With Artmachine, you can take an existing artwork and produce a large number of mutated variations, selecting the most compelling ones to refine further.
This process mirrors natural selection, allowing artists to guide their art’s evolution in a structured yet open-ended way. The result is a creative system that feels less like a conventional design tool and more like a living, evolving ecosystem. You can take control, refining each iteration, or embrace serendipity and let the machine surprise you.


Who is Artmachine For?
Artmachine is for anyone curious about generative art—whether you're a seasoned creative coder, a digital artist looking for new ways to experiment, or someone with no programming experience who simply wants to explore algorithmic beauty. The web-based interface makes it easy to dive in, while the depth of the system offers limitless creative potential.
The way I think about it: Artmachine is more than just a tool; it is a vessel for exploration, a telescope into the vast, infinite space of possible artworks. The sheer number of potential creations is unimaginable, and to be honest: Navigating this universe isn’t always easy. But when you do discover something beautiful, it feels and often is truly unique—like stumbling upon a distant, undiscovered star. Each artwork you find or create may be something no one else has ever seen before.
So why not give it a try? Create something beautiful, let your artwork evolve, and see where the machine takes you!
